概括
智能农业中的移动机器人可以降低成本和环境影响. 开发无服务器的自主,低成本系统是可持续农业和优化收获的关键.

背景情况:
- 耕地稀缺需要增加粮食生产,粮农组织预计到2050年粮食产量将增加三分之一.
- 对于作物产量而言,密集地使用肥料会对食品的营养质量产生负面影响.
- 移动机器人在农业中越来越多地用于路径规划和数据收集,以应对生产力和可持续性挑战.
研究的目的:
- 审查移动机器人在农业中的应用,以降低成本,最大限度地减少环境影响,并优化收获.
- 确定智能农业中移动机器人的现状,技术,算法和结果.
- 为先进的智能农业技术提出挑战并提出解决方案.
主要方法:
- 审查当前在农业中的移动机器人应用.
- 分析包括物联网 (IoT),人工智能 (AI),人工视觉和大数据在内的技术.
- 检查路径规划,作物信息收集和多目标控制的算法.
主要成果:
- 由于客户端-服务器架构,当前的农业机器人系统往往是大型和昂贵的.
- 移动机器人,物联网,人工智能,人工视觉,多目标控制和大数据正在引领智能农业技术.
- 一个完全自主,低成本的农业移动机器人系统独立于服务器是一个可行的技术解决方案.
结论:
- 移动机器人提供了一条减少农业成本,环境影响和优化收获的途径.
- 智能农业的关键技术包括物联网,移动机器人,人工智能,人工视觉,多目标控制和大数据.
- 克服环境条件,成本,技术要求,自动化,连接和处理能力方面的挑战对于广泛采用至关重要.
